A member asked:

I have painful spasms in my left calf for no reason. i don't really exercise, however i have moderate oa in that knee. what could it be?

A doctor has provided 1 answer

Muscle pain: Recurrent muscle cramping of the calf suggests there is much baseline tightness in the muscle. This may be indirectly related to your knee problem. Daily or nightly stretching of the calf muscles should help prevent painful muscle cramps or spasms. Taking magnesium daily may reduce muscle irritability also. :)
